Description |
A remote overflow exists in Novell eDirectory iMonitor on Windows. iMonitor fails to handle malformed HTTP GET requests resulting in a stack overflow. With a specially crafted request, an attacker can execute arbitrary code with SYSTEM privileges resulting in a loss of integrity.

Solution |
Currently, there are no known workarounds or upgrades to correct this issue. However, Novell has released a patch to address this vulnerability.
